Analysis

In 2022, africa's development dynamics (afdd) table 32 - employment by in Georgia stood at 39.5 Persons.

The figure is up 4.8% on the previous year and up 67.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, africa's development dynamics (afdd) table 32 - employment by in Georgia peaked at 48.36 Persons in 2019 and was at its lowest, 14.73 Persons, in 2002.

That places Georgia 124th out of 161 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 23 years of available data.

The Statistical Annex to the annual Africa's Development Dynamics (AFDD) report is a collection of development indicators that were gathered and analysed while conducting the research that went into the report. These data are also available online for free viewing or download at https://oe.cd/AFDD-2024, a bilingual website which links to the electronic version of the Africa's Development Dynamics book in both English and French. Table 32 shows total employment by sex and within 14 different economic sectors.
